Introduction
User Interface (UI) development plays a critical role
in web and mobile application development, ensuring that users have an
intuitive, efficient, and visually appealing experience. A UI Development
Course provides the necessary skills and knowledge to design and develop
functional user interfaces using various front-end technologies. This article
explores the key aspects of UI development, the topics covered in a UI
development course, and the career opportunities available in this field.
What is UI Development?
UI development involves designing and coding the
front-end elements of a website or application that users interact with. It
focuses on enhancing usability, accessibility, and aesthetics. UI developers
use technologies like HTML,
CSS, JavaScript, and frameworks such as React, Angular, and Vue.js
to build engaging interfaces.
Importance of Learning UI Development
- High
Demand for UI Developers: With digital
transformation, businesses require skilled UI developers to create
seamless user experiences.
- Better
Career Prospects: A UI development course can
lead to various job roles, including UI
Developer, Front-End Developer, Web Developer, and UX Engineer.
- Enhanced
Creativity: UI development combines coding with
design, allowing developers to create visually stunning applications.
- Improved
User Engagement: A well-designed UI can boost user
satisfaction and business conversions.
Topics Covered in a UI Development Course
A well-structured UI Development Course
typically covers the following topics:
1. Introduction to UI and UX
- Understanding
UI vs. UX
- Principles
of UI Design
- Wireframing
and Prototyping
2. HTML & CSS Fundamentals
- Structuring
web pages with HTML5
- Styling
with CSS3 (Flexbox, Grid, Animations)
- Responsive
Design with Media Queries
3. JavaScript for UI Development
- JavaScript
Basics (ES6+ features)
- DOM
Manipulation and Event Handling
- Asynchronous
JavaScript (Promises, Async/Await)
4. Front-End Frameworks & Libraries
- Introduction
to React,
Angular, and Vue.js
- Building
Components and State Management
- Using
APIs and Fetching Data
5. UI Development Tools and Best Practices
- Version
Control with Git and GitHub
- CSS
Preprocessors (SASS, LESS)
- Performance
Optimization and SEO for UI
6. Testing and Debugging
- Browser
Developer Tools
- Unit
Testing and Debugging Techniques
7. Deployment and Hosting
- Hosting
UI Applications on Netlify, Vercel, or Firebase
- CI/CD
(Continuous Integration and Deployment)
A UI Development
course opens up various career opportunities, especially in the tech industry,
where companies prioritize user-friendly and visually appealing interfaces.
Here are some key career paths:
1. UI Developer
- Build
responsive and interactive web applications using HTML, CSS, JavaScript,
and frameworks like React, Angular, or Vue.js.
- Salary:
₹4-8 LPA (India) / $60K-$120K (US)
2. Frontend Developer
- Specialize
in enhancing website interactivity and performance.
- Work
with APIs, browser rendering, and optimization.
- Salary:
₹5-12 LPA (India) / $70K-$140K (US)
3. Web Developer
- Create
and maintain websites, ensuring cross-browser compatibility.
- Use
CMS
platforms like WordPress, Shopify, or Joomla.
- Salary:
₹3-8 LPA (India) / $50K-$100K (US)
4. UX/UI Designer
- Pay
attention to interface (UI) and user experience (UX) design.
- Use
tools like Figma, Adobe XD, or Sketch.
- Salary:
₹5-10 LPA (India) / $65K-$130K (US)
5. Mobile UI Developer
- Design
interfaces for mobile apps using React Native, Flutter, or SwiftUI.
- Work
closely with mobile app developers and designers.
- Salary:
₹6-12 LPA (India) / $70K-$140K (US)
6. Product Designer
- Work
with product teams to create seamless user experiences.
- Conduct
user research and usability testing.
- Salary:
₹7-15 LPA (India) / $80K-$150K (US)
7. UI/UX Consultant
- Offer
expertise in UI/UX development to various companies.
- Work
as a freelancer or part of a consulting firm.
- Salary:
₹10-20 LPA (India) / $90K-$160K (US)
8. Full Stack Developer (UI
+ Backend Development)
- Work
on both UI and server-side development using Node.js,
Express, or Django.
- Salary:
₹6-15 LPA (India) / $80K-$140K (US)
Industries Hiring UI
Developers
- IT
& Software Development
- E-commerce
- Fintech
- Edtech
- Healthcare
Tech
- Media
& Entertainment
Career Opportunities in UI Development
After completing a UI Development Course, candidates
can explore various job roles, including:
- UI
Developer – Specializes in building
interactive user interfaces.
- Front-End
Developer – Works on both UI and front-end
logic.
- Web
Designer – Focuses on the visual and
interactive aspects of websites.
- UX/UI
Designer – Combines design thinking with UI
development. Infocampus
has established itself as a leader in UI Development training in Bangalore
due to several key factors:
- Comprehensive
Curriculum and Experienced Trainers: The institute
offers a well-structured UI Development course that covers essential
technologies such as HTML, CSS, JavaScript, and various frameworks.
Training is delivered by experienced IT professionals who provide
practical, hands-on learning experiences.
- Positive
Student Feedback: Numerous students have praised
Infocampus for its quality education and effective teaching methods. For
instance, a review on UrbanPro highlights, "It was my right decision
to join Infocampus training institute. My career has been brightened by
the Infocampus team."
- Placement
Assistance: Infocampus is tied up with over
1,077 domestic IT companies, providing robust placement support to its
students. This extensive network enhances job opportunities for graduates.
- Flexible
Learning Options: The institute offers both weekday
and weekend classes, accommodating the diverse schedules of students and
working professionals.
- These
factors collectively contribute to Infocampus's reputation as a leading
provider of UI Development courses in Bangalore.
Conclusion
A UI Development Course is an excellent
investment for anyone aspiring to build a career in web or mobile development.
With the increasing demand for skilled UI developers, learning these skills can
open doors to exciting job opportunities and creative possibilities. Whether you
are a beginner or an experienced professional looking to upgrade your skills,
UI development offers a rewarding career path in the ever-growing digital
industry.
Elevate your career with UI Development Training in
Bangalore at Infocampus. Gain hands-on skills, expert guidance, and industry
insights to excel in web design. Enroll now and transform your future! Limited seats available, don't
miss out! For more details Call: 8884166608 or 9740557058
Visit: https://infocampus.co.in/ui-development-training-in-bangalore.html
No comments:
Post a Comment